How small mammal personalities influence forest regeneration

Scattered across the Penobscot Experimental Forest are veritable treasure troves for its denizens, each containing riches beyond comprehension. These caches do not contain gold or jewels—they’re filled with eastern white pine seeds and were placed by a team of researchers at the University of Maine for one purpose: to catch furry thieves red-handed. Evolutionary origins of colorful damselfly’s female color variation unraveled

For more than 20 years, a research team at Lund University in Sweden has studied the common bluetail damselfly. Females occur in three different color forms—one with a male-like appearance, something that protects them from mating harassment.
